About The Position

The Design Engineer I will be responsible for providing engineered drawings for HVAC control systems. This role involves reviewing project specifications and contract drawings, creating accurate drawings and schematics using Visio, and sizing control components such as valves, dampers, and air flow stations. The engineer will also be responsible for writing and understanding sequences of operations for HVAC control systems, and assembling submittals and O&Ms for projects.
